PC SOFT

PROFESSIONAL NEWSGROUPS
WINDEVWEBDEV and WINDEV Mobile

Home → WINDEV 2024 → cConsole et les caractères spéciaux
cConsole et les caractères spéciaux
Started by MJMS Informatique, Apr., 19 2021 11:27 AM - 3 replies
Registered member
39 messages
Posted on April, 19 2021 - 11:27 AM
Bonjour à tous,

Je continue à me battre avec différentes solutions dont cConsole (qui ne fonctionne pas en projet UNICODE) dernière version, tous mon code est fonctionnel en ANSI, problème : dans le retour de la console, les caractères autres que le Français ne s'affiche pas correctement et son non lisible, je parle par exemple des caractères polonais, russe , etc.

--
Librement,

MJ

https://doc.mjms-informatique.pro
https://www.mjms-informatique.pro
Registered member
962 messages
Popularité : +183 (185 votes)
Posted on April, 19 2021 - 2:12 PM
hello,
il me semble qu'il faut faire évoluer la classe pour utiliser des API de type W pour l'unicode. Je ne suis pas spécialiste donc ce n'est pas moi qui m'en chargerait ;(

--
Ami calmant, J.P
Registered member
3,346 messages
Popularité : +93 (137 votes)
Posted on April, 19 2021 - 4:12 PM
A ma connaissance, dans la console c'est de l'oem par défaut
Ça fait longtemps que j'ai pas regardé le code de la classe
Mais regarde du côté de AnsiVersOem et OemVersAnsi
Dans l'aide il est écrit
Attention : Ne pas utiliser la fonction OemVersAnsi avec une chaîne de caractères contenant des caractères spécifiques ANSI (caractères accentués) : ces caractères seront transformés et le résultat sera incorrect.
Registered member
39 messages
Posted on April, 19 2021 - 6:11 PM
Merci pour vos réponses, effectivement, OemVersAnsi dégrade encore plus, et OemVersUnicode n'existe pas... 2021 et nous voila toujours coincé par la problématique des langues ^^

--
Librement,

MJ

https://doc.mjms-informatique.pro
https://www.mjms-informatique.pro